INTRODUCTION: The United States Air Force, 68th Rescue Squadron (68th RQS) is seeking sources that can provide and install 125 Smooth Parachute Packing Mats .





CONUS Location



68th RQS complex, at Davis-Monthan Air Force Base (DMAFB), AZ.






  1. DISCLAIMER: This sources sought notice is issued for information and planning purposes only.This is not a Request for Proposal (RFP). It is not to be construed as a commitment by the Government to issue a solicitation or ultimately award a contract. Responses will not be considered as proposals nor will any award be made as a result of this sources sought notice. The Air Force will NOT be responsible for any costs incurred by interested parties in responding to this request for information.



Description:



The 68th RQS is seeking the procurement of 125 Parachute Packing Mats. These packing mats will be used to properly and safely store parachutes.
